Cromwell Hall – A Landmark Period Residence of Grace and Grandeur

Tucked away in a private, idyllic setting, Cromwell Hall is a distinguished detached period home of striking architectural beauty, set within approximately 1.8 acres of mature gardens and grounds. This exceptional residence spans over 4,480 sqft of internal space, blending classical proportions, elegant detailing, and refined interiors to offer a lifestyle of timeless sophistication.

A magnificent galleried entrance hall sets a commanding tone upon entry, offering a seamless flow into the principal reception rooms. The formal drawing room stretches to nearly 28 feet in length, offering grandeur on a scale ideal for entertaining, with tall sash windows, a feature fireplace, and garden views. A beautifully appointed dining room provides the perfect setting for more intimate gatherings, while a double-aspect family room and separate study offer additional, versatile living spaces—each showcasing period features such as ornate fireplaces and original woodwork.

At the heart of the home lies a generous kitchen and breakfast room, thoughtfully designed with granite worktops, butler sink, a gas-fired AGA, integrated appliances, and bespoke cabinetry. A built-in dining nook, traditional larder, and stable door to the garden complete the space, creating a warm and functional hub for daily life. A large utility/dog room with direct access to the outdoors, and a cloakroom completes the ground floor accommodation.

Upstairs, a sweeping galleried landing leads to four substantial bedrooms across the first and second floors. The principal suite is a serene retreat, boasting a charming fireplace, bespoke wardrobes, and a beautifully refitted ensuite with a freestanding roll-top bath and walk-in shower. Bedrooms two and three also enjoy ensuite bathrooms, while the fourth bedroom, located on the top floor, benefits from its own shower room and expansive eaves wardrobe space—perfect for guests, older children or as an additional suite.

Beyond the main house, the property continues to impress. A sweeping gravel driveway leads to a three-bay barn-style garage with an adjacent log store. To the rear, a private paddock hosts a detached studio and separate office with veranda—perfect for creative work, wellness pursuits or a home business setup. The mature gardens wrap around the house and offer a mix of formal lawned areas, entertaining terraces, and peaceful pockets of woodland and planting.

Chartham Golf and Country Club is moments away, offering an array of facilities, with train stations of Lingfield, East Grinstead and Dormans Park nearby too, along with their various amenities.
